WebStudents were given a paint brush, tray, paper, water, and plenty of paper towel sheets. We used liquid tempera and I instructed the kids to put about 3-4 drops on three different sections on their tray (using only blue, yellow, and red). From there, the students used the remaining sections on the trays for mixing their colors. Cobalt is a delicate blue, which has a cooler colour temperature. It is an artificial mineral pigment and has been available since the early 19th century. It derives from treated cobalt oxide and aluminium oxide.
